Should women worry?


I'm a woman. Am I at greater risk for cancer than coronary artery disease?




Previous 1 Answers
Posted by Just Jules
That's a huge misconception, as CAD is the #1 cause of death in women. We've worked so hard to bring breast cancer to the forefront that it's easy to see how this very serious disease has crept up on us. Plus, women as a rule tend to ignore their symptoms and go on about business. There are also differences in the symptoms between women and men as well as causes. For instance, men tend to develop a heart attack during exercise while women experience it more during times of stress or even at rest.
